  • Patent number: 11591422
    Abstract: A method can be used for manufacturing an ethylene-propylene-diene terpolymer for a fuel cell. A polymerization step includes subjecting an organic chelate compound forming a coordinate bond, a vanadium-based Ziegler-Natta catalyst, an organoaluminum compound, and ethylene, propylene, and diene monomers, together with a solvent, to polymerization in a reactor. A separation step includes recovering residual catalysts and unreacted monomers from the stream discharged from the reactor. An acquisition step includes recovering the solvent from the stream deprived of the residual catalysts and unreacted monomers to acquire the ethylene-propylene-diene terpolymer.

  • Patent number: 11220566
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for preparing an ethylene-based elastic copolymer, and more particularly, to a method for preparing an ethylene-based elastic copolymer by using a catalyst composition for preparing an ethylene-based elastic copolymer, the catalyst composition comprising a binuclear constrained geometry transition metal compound, as a main catalyst, having a structural advantage to obtain a high-molecular-weight ethylene-based elastic copolymer due to a high polymerization activity and comonomer reactivity because the binuclear constrained geometry transition metal compound has a structure in which cyclopentadiene ligands of two constrained geometry catalysts are linked by 1,4-phenylene, and one or more cocatalyst compounds selected from the group consisting of an organoaluminum compound, an organoaluminoxane compound, and a boron compound.

  • Patent number: 7119157
    Abstract: Disclosed herein is a method of preparing an EP(D)M elastomer, which includes pre-cooling a reactive solvent to ?80 to ?100° C.; and polymerizing ethylene, at least one higher ?-olefin having 3 to 18 carbons, and selectively, at least one conjugated or non-conjugated diene having 5 to 15 carbons, in the presence of the reactive solvent. According to the method of the current invention, the yield of the EP(D)M elastomer is drastically increased even though a conventional preparation device is used unchanged. Further, methods of controlling the yield of the EP(D)M elastomer and of recovering the EP(D)M elastomer are provided.
